Dear All,

When I check the system from RSDDBIAMON, there is a result as :

"Check for inconsistent logical indexes" and from the details I get :

"brli086a 32003 b2p_bic:fzpa_cth02 Not all parts of the logical index exist"

When I attempt to rebuild BIA indexes on the mentioned cube, it does not work. Screen freezes, no job is started in SM37.

All I can do is to "stop the transaction".

Could please give your advices for this situation, how should I proceed ? What to check ?

Execute the program RSDDTREX_INDEX_ADJUST on the cube. This should fix your issue.

This used to happen to use when one of the blades was down or overloaded and we usually restarted the particular blade and rebuilt the same.

The situation happens when Indexing is stopped midway and not all the tables of the cube are indexes - in particular the dimension tables or the Facte table is not indexed... and the index becomes inconsistent.
